This painting shows a woman in Ming-style robes standing against a blank wall. Her face is turned slightly, eyes downcast. The colors are muted, mostly browns and tans. Chen Hongshou painted this late in life. His figures look stiff but full of quiet energy. He copied old masters but added his own twist. His style feels like tiny Chinese gardens.
